DAVID JOSEPH PAUL MENARD June 29, 1940 - March 30, 2016 It is with deep sorrow that we announce the sudden passing of a wonderful, kind and gentle husband, dad and grandpa. David passed away Wednesday March 30, 2016 at the Chandler Hospital in Arizona. David was predeceased by sisters, Jeanette, Annette, Irene, Lillian, and Estelle; as well as brothers, Lou, Arthur, and Edmond; parents, Ernest and Dorothy; and numerous in-laws. He most recently mourned the loss of his niece Rhonda Lepage-Bracken. He is survived by his siblings Juliette (Gerry), Mona (Ed), Elena; and sister-in-law Shirley Menard. David made many great memories with, and will be sadly missed by, his wife Lea (Dandeneau); daughters, Connie (Chris), Adele (Rick), Shelly (Trevor), son Keith; and grandchildren, Danny, Elissa, Rhea and Lucas. David was born in Fisher Branch, MB to Ernest and Dorothy Menard. He was the second youngest of twelve children. David worked at the Misericordia hospital for 30 years as a urology technician to support his family. A devoted family man, he loved his wife, children and grandchildren unconditionally. David and Lea attended many dances, Goldeyes games, grandkids' activities and they loved playing cards. He enjoyed curling, watching sports and TV game shows.
